Department of Corrections celebrates Assistance Dog Week
By channel3000.com
Published: 08/07/2018

MADISON, Wis. - The Wisconsin Department of Corrections is celebrating service dog training programs at a number of Department facilities following Gov. Scott Walker's proclamation of Aug. 5-11 as Assistance Dog Week.

"Assistance Dog Week is a great time to celebrate the work that inmates do to provide more assistance dogs for the community,” said Alan Peters, executive director of Can Do Canines, which works with Jackson Correctional Institution and Stanley Correctional Institution. “The work being done changes lives and saves lives of people with disabilities.”
